How WJW’s Facebook Page Became the Most Popular Station Page in the Country

By Andrew Gauthier 

WJW’s Facebook page is the most popular station page in the country with over 165,000 fans and counting. So how has the Cleveland Fox-affiliate been able to garner so many Likes?

Lost Remote, which has an insightful post today about WJW‘s Facebook strategy, has a few keys to the station’s social media success.

One is a franchise titled “Facebook Friend of the Day” in which WJW’s morning show gives a daily shout-out to a new Facebook fan.

The other is a Facebook campaign that the station ran in September, promising to donate $2,500 to an area animal shelter if WJW reached 100,000 fans in a week. Video inside…

WJW didn’t end up reaching its goal of 100,000 but the campaign did provide an impressive spike in traffic and the station donated to the shelter anyway.
